Calendar – Films/Documentaries – Modern Classics to Screen “The King’s Speech” – Jan. 26

Marquette – Modern Classics will offer a free screening of “The King’s Speech” on Thursday, January 26 at 6:30 p.m. in the Community Room of the Peter White Public Library.

Starring Colin Firth, Geoffrey Rush, and Helena Bonham Carter, the film is the story of King George VI of the United Kingdom, his improptu ascension to the throne and the speech therapist who helped the unsure monarch become worth of it.

“The King’s Speech” was released in 2010, is rated R and runs for 118 minutes. There is no admission charge. For more information, go to www.pwpl.info.
